* A panda and a giraffe are 300 feet apart when they start moving towards each other. The panda is running at a speed of P feet per minute, and the giraffe is running G feet per minute faster. How fast are they approaching each other?

Answer:

(2P + G) ft/min

Explanation:

P = speed of panda

P + G = speed of giraffe

rate of approach = speed of panda + speed of giraffe

= P + P + G

= 2P + G

The panda and the giraffe are approaching each other at a rate

of (2P + G) ft/min.
